Abstract
The invention discloses a kind of soil remediation equipment and its working methods, belt conveyor is inputted including soil, soil exports belt conveyor, microwave heating container, gas pollutant removal stirring water tank and sewage water filtration adsorption box, microwave heating container can carry out heating reparation to being delivered to the soil in it by soil input belt conveyor, and it is provided in microwave heating container and tumbles several regular conical soil kuppes of water conservancy diversion and several reverse frustoconic soil kuppes for soil, it is contained with clear water in gas pollutant removal stirring water tank, and water tank is mating is provided with multiple rabbling mechanisms for gas pollutant removal stirring, the interior bottom of gas pollutant removal stirring water tank is connected by Y-type three way type aqueduct with the inner top of sewage water filtration adsorption box, multiple filtering absorbing units are provided in sewage water filtration adsorption box.A kind of soil remediation equipment and its working method, simple operation, soil remediation provided by the invention are more thorough.

As shown in Fig. 1, a kind of soil remediation equipment, including soil input belt conveyor 1, soil export Belt Conveying
Machine 2, microwave heating container 5, gas pollutant removal stirring water tank 3 and sewage water filtration adsorption box 4;
There is the microwave heating container 5 feed inlet 15 and discharge port 90, the soil input correspondence of belt conveyor 1 to set
It is placed in the feed inlet 15 of microwave heating container 5, the soil output belt conveyor 2 is correspondingly arranged in microwave heating container 5
Discharge port 90, the microwave heating container 5 can be heated to being delivered to the soil in it by soil input belt conveyor 1
It repairs, and is provided in microwave heating container 5 and tumbles several regular conical soil kuppes 16 of water conservancy diversion and several for soil
Reverse frustoconic soil kuppe 17 makes organic matter gradually volatilize during heating, reaches by way of being heated to soil
The purpose effectively removed to organic matter in soil, organic matter removal is more thorough, improves the efficiency of soil remediation;And it heats
Mode is microwave heating, and the efficiency of heating surface is higher, easy to operate, and can be reduced environmental pollution to a certain extent;
It is contained with clear water in the gas pollutant removal stirring water tank 3, the inner top of the microwave heating container 5 passes through
The interior bottom that outlet pipe 9 removes stirring water tank 3 with gas pollutant is connected, and gas pollutant removal stirring water tank 3 is mating
Multiple rabbling mechanisms 63 are provided with, gas pollutant removal stirring water tank will be passed through doped with the gas of volatile organic compounds pollutant
In clear water in 3, to which the organic pollutant dissolving in gas to be adsorbed in water, then the purified treatment of sewage is carried out, reached
To the purpose of soil remediation;
It is adsorbed by Y-type three way type aqueduct 34 and sewage water filtration the interior bottom of the gas pollutant removal stirring water tank 3
The inner top of case 4 is connected, and multiple filtering absorbing units 70 are provided in the sewage water filtration adsorption box 4, and multiple filterings are inhaled
Coupon member 70 can be filtered for multiple times the sewage being guided in water filtering adsorption tank 4 by Y-type three way type aqueduct 34, be adsorbed,
The dirty water decontamination handles are more thorough, and effect is good, efficient.
As shown in Figure 1 and Figure 2, the feed inlet 15 of the microwave heating container 5 is located at the top of microwave heating container 5
The soil output end in portion, the soil input belt conveyor 1 is located at feed inlet 15;The mating setting of the feed inlet 15 is flexible
Automatically-controlled door 20, can be defeated by inputting the soil of belt conveyor 1 from soil by 20 closed feed inlet 15 of the elastic automatically-controlled door
The soil of outlet output drop, which is hit, to be opened, and this design of elastic automatically-controlled door 20, which is hit when needing to open by soil, to be opened,
Automatic closure is realized when need not open, and completely without labor management or accesses other control devices, simple in structure, cost
Relatively low, using effect is very good.
As shown in figures 4 and 5, the elastic automatically-controlled door 20 includes 21, two 22 and of right angle trigonometry block of trigone mast
Two springs 23, the both sides inner wall of the material inlet 15 offer cavity 30 respectively, the trigone mast 21 across material into
Mouthfuls 15 and bottom of chamber of its both ends respectively with two cavitys 30 fix, and the long rib of one of trigone mast 21 is upward and face object
Expect that import 15 is arranged;Two right angle trigonometry blocks 22 are slidably equipped on trigone mast 21, and two right angles three
The inclined-plane of hornblock 22 is oppositely arranged, and can effectively be slowed down and be hindered caused by when trigone mast 21 enters microwave heating container 5 soil
Hinder effect, but also soil can be prevented to be accumulated on trigone mast 21;Two springs 23 are respectively symmetrically set in right angle
In the bar portion of trigone mast 21 between corner block 22 and the bottom of chamber of cavity 30, each spring 23 all has rebound thrust,
Two right angle trigonometry blocks 22 abut the V for constituting opening face material inlet 15 under the promotion of corresponding spring 23
The V-arrangement door 24 of shape door 24, this structure can be opened quickly when soil is hit, and using effect is preferable.
As shown in Fig. 2, the inner space of the microwave heating container 5 is cylinder, the regular conical soil water conservancy diversion
Cover 16 is arranged alternately with reverse frustoconic soil kuppe 17 inside microwave heating container 5 from top to bottom;From the feed inlet 15
Nearest is regular conical soil kuppe 16, and the tip face feed inlet 15 of this regular conical soil kuppe 16, is ensured
Entering the soil of microwave heating container 5 from feed inlet 15 by water conservancy diversion and can be split.
The shroud rim of the cone soil kuppe 16 and the inner wall of microwave heating container 5 have a spacing 18, it is described fall
The inner wall seamless connection at expansion the cover mouth edge and microwave heating container 5 of truncated cone-shaped soil kuppe 17, and conical soil is led
The shrinking hood mouth for the reverse frustoconic soil kuppe 17 that the tip face of stream cover 16 is positioned above.
Conical soil kuppe 16 is so that soil is constantly tumbled dispersion so that soil is uniformly heated, and is then fallen
Enter and tumbled convergence on reverse frustoconic soil kuppe 17 again, and so on, it is total in microwave heating container 5 to increase soil
Body tumbles stroke so that the organic matter in soil is able to be heated volatilization to greatest extent, further such that soil remediation is more
It is thorough, improves the efficiency that soil heating is repaired.
As shown in attached drawing 6 and attached drawing 7, opened on the cone soil kuppe 16 and reverse frustoconic soil kuppe 17
Equipped with several ventholes 19 being evenly distributed, the setting of venthole 19 can be such that soil is come into full contact with hot gas, accelerate in soil
The volatilization of organic matter, and since conical soil kuppe 16 and 17 unique structure of reverse frustoconic soil kuppe construct
At so that the organic matter volatilized from soil is thoroughly taken away.
As shown in Fig. 1, further include microwave heating box 6 and air blower 7, heat exchanger tube is provided in the microwave heating box 6
10, the microwave heating box 6 can exchange the heating of heat pipe 10;The outlet air end of the air blower 7 is connected to one end of heat exchanger tube 10, institute
The other end for stating heat exchanger tube 10 is connected by admission line 11 with the interior bottom of microwave heating container 5.
As shown in Fig. 3, in order to carry out being filtered for multiple times of sewage, adsorb, to ensure the more thorough of the dirty water decontamination handles,
Multiple filtering absorbing units 70 are uniformly distributed from top to bottom in sewage water filtration adsorption box 4;The filtering absorbing unit 70
Including arc-shaped filtering adsorption plate 71 and the arc-shaped weather board 72 being arranged immediately below arc-shaped filtering adsorption plate 71, the circle
Arc filtering adsorption plate 71 is identical as the radian of arc-shaped weather board 72 and opening is arranged upward;The sewage water filtration adsorption box
4 both sides box wall is respectively arranged with connecting plate 12, two of the arc-shaped filtering adsorption plate 71 it is high-end respectively with connecting plate 12
It is fixedly connected;The arc-shaped filtering adsorption plate 71 includes double-layer filter plate 50 and activated carbon filled layer 51, and the activated carbon is filled out
Layer 51 is filled to be filled in the interlayer of double-layer filter plate 50;There are two conduit pipes for the short end setting of the arc-shaped weather board 72
80, the water outlet of two conduit pipes 80 extends respectively to two of the arc-shaped filtering adsorption plate 71 positioned at its adjacent lower section
It is a high-end, arc-shaped 71 unique structure of filtering adsorption plate, in conjunction with the design of two conduit pipes 80 on arc-shaped weather board 72,
It then ensure that sewage from the high-end inflow low side of arc-shaped filtering adsorption plate 71, can increase sewage in arc-shaped filtering adsorption plate
71 flowing stroke and the mobility of sewage itself, sewage water filtration, adsorption effect are good, efficient.
As shown in Fig. 1,4 bottom of sewage water filtration adsorption box is provided with the water collection tank 8 communicated therewith, on water collection tank 8
It is provided with drainpipe 38, the second control valve 62 is installed on drainpipe 38.
As shown in Fig. 3, the Y-type three way type aqueduct includes interconnected leading water pipe 35 and two secondary aqueducts
40, the interior bottom that the leading water pipe 35 removes stirring water tank 3 with gas pollutant is connected, and is equipped on leading water pipe 35
First control valve 61;The water outlet of two secondary aqueducts 40 extends respectively to two height of arc-shaped filtering adsorption plate 71
End, ensureing that sewage is initially guided in sewage water filtration adsorption box 4 will flow down from arc-shaped filter adsorption plate 71 two are high-end.
As shown in Fig. 1, air is polluted in order to avoid gas is expelled directly out, the gas pollutant removal stirring
Water tank 3 is connected it and is internally provided with residual air conduit 60, and the terminal of the residual air conduit 60 extends to gas purification processing system.
A kind of working method of soil remediation equipment, is as follows:
Step 1:Start air blower 7, and by microwave heating box 6 exchange heat pipe 10 heated, extraneous normal temperature air into
Enter the heat exchange of heat exchanger tube 10 to form hot gas and enter microwave heating container 5;
Step 2:Belt conveyor 1 being inputted by soil, soil being delivered to microwave heating container 5, soil is defeated from soil
Enter and fallen on belt conveyor 1, hit two right angle trigonometry blocks 22, two right angle trigonometry blocks 22 towards in cavity 30 it is mobile open into
Material mouth 15, soil enter microwave heating container 5 by feed inlet 15 and carry out heating reparation;
Soil falls that it tumbles and is split in first 16 upper edge of regular conical soil kuppe first, then falls into first
Continue to tumble on a reverse frustoconic soil kuppe 17, so recycles, be finally expelled to from the discharge port 90 of microwave heating container 5
Soil output belt conveyor 2 is conveyed;
Soil heats in repair process, and the organic matter in soil gradually volatilizees, and is carried and led by outlet pipe 9 by hot gas
It flow to gas pollutant removal stirring water tank 3;
Step 3:It opens rabbling mechanism 63 to be stirred the water in gas pollutant removal stirring water tank 3, make in gas
The dissolving of the pollutants such as the volatile organic compounds of carrying is adsorbed in water, forms sewage;Residual gas is guided to by residual air conduit 60
Gas purification processing system carries out gas purification processing;
Step 4:The first control valve 36 is opened, the sewage in gas pollutant removal stirring water tank 3 passes through Y-type three way type
Aqueduct 34 is guided to sewage water filtration adsorption box 4, is flow to after the shunting of two secondary aqueducts 40 of Y-type three way type aqueduct 34
Two of arc-shaped filtering adsorption plate 71 are high-end, and slowly flow down, and double-layer filter plate 50 is filtered sewage during this, goes
Except the particulate pollutant in sewage, activated carbon filled layer 51 adsorbs sewage, removes the peculiar smell in sewage;
Water after filtering, adsorbing is gathered together by arc-shaped weather board 72, and is guided to by two conduit pipes 80
Two of next arc-shaped filtering adsorption plate 71 are high-end, continue filtering, absorption, so repeat down, that is, form clear water,
Clear water is assembled in the last one arc-shaped weather board 72 and is guided in water storage box 15 by two conduit pipes 80.
